Abstract


Insects affecting citrus are many which the fruit sucking moths.the citrus butterfly.the leaf miner et.are the most troublesome.Besides insects there are mites (Acarina)which occasionally do some damage. One of these--Tetrany - chus(Schizotetranychus)hindustanicus,Hirst.sucks the leafsap with the result that discoloured patches are produced on the leaves.The adult mites which are greenish yellow in colour are found also on Perison neem,margosa and 'curryleaf'plant.
